About Cricket

Field crickets (Acheta assimilis and others) occur all over the western hemisphere and are primarily an agricultural pest. Crickets have been reported to damage grain crops as well as fruits and vegetables. Around the home, cricket populations live mostly in turf but present a nuisance by invading cellars and garages during the late summer. Annoying chirping is usually the biggest concern, but crickets have been known to damage articles made of fabrics and leather.
